DYE FIXING AGENT 

DYE FIXING ADDITIVE COMES UNDER THE CATEGORY OF SCREEN PRINTING INK ADDITIVE. IT IS EFFECTIVE IN IMPROVING COLOUR AND WASHING FASTNESS. DYE FIXING AGENT IS ADDED WITH OTHER WATER BASED INK LIKE WHITE WATER BASED NON PVC INK, WATER BASED METALLIC INKS, PIGMNET PRINTING INKS ETC. THE PERCENTAGE OF DYE FIXING TO BE USED IS BETWEEN 3-5 %.DYE FIXING ADDITIVE SHOULD BE ADDED AT THE FINAL STAGE OF CHEMCAL MIXING JUST BEFORE SCREEN PRINTING STARTS .DYE FIXING ADDITIVE SHOULD BE STORED AWAY FROM DIRECT SUNLIGHT. DYE FIXING AGENT NEED A CURING TIME OF 1 MINUTE AT 160 DEGREE CELSIUS.

Dye Fixing Agent Product Description

A Dye Fixing Agent is a chemical compound used in the textile and dyeing industries to enhance the color fastness of dyed fabrics. These agents work by forming a bond between the dye and the fabric, ensuring that the color remains vibrant and does not wash out or fade over time. They are particularly important for fabrics that will undergo frequent washing or exposure to sunlight. The use of dye fixing agents is essential for achieving high-quality, durable textiles that meet consumer expectations for color retention.

Uses of Dye Fixing Agents

  • Textile Industry: Primarily used in the dyeing process of cotton, wool, silk, and synthetic fibers to improve color fastness.
  • Paper Industry: Employed to enhance the color retention of dyes used in paper products.
  • Leather Industry: Utilized in the dyeing of leather to ensure that colors remain intact during wear and exposure to moisture.
  • Cosmetics: Some dye fixing agents are used in cosmetic formulations to stabilize colorants in products like hair dyes and makeup.
  • Food Industry: Certain agents are used to fix colors in food products, ensuring that they remain appealing over time.
